Ivan Sergeyevich Lozenkov (Russian: Иван Серге́евич Лозенков; born 14 April 1984) is a Russian former professional football player.

He played for the main squad of Zenit St. Petersburg in the Russian Premier League Cup.
In October 2009, he received a contusion when a fan threw a firecracker at him from the stands. Early in 2009, he played for the farm club of Zenit called Smena-Zenit and was the team's captain. Zenit fans considered him transferring to the rival Dynamo St. Petersburg team as betrayal.[1]
